We present a measurement of the radiative decay η→π0γγ using 82 million η mesons produced in e+e-→ϕ→ηγ process at the Frascati ϕ-factory DAΦNE. From the data analysis 1246±133 signal events are observed. By normalising the signal to the well-known η→3π0 decay the branching fraction \cal B(η→π0γγ) is measured to be (0.98± 0.11stat± 0.14syst)×10-4. This result agrees with a preliminary KLOE measurement, but is twice smaller than the present world average. Results for dΓ(η→π0γγ)/dM2(γγ) are also presented and compared with latest theory predictions.
